Hey guys Im pretty new to this whole hacking thing as i just found out about this site very recently.

One problem I have with hacking however is that when I implement a custom sprite in the game, it would sometimes crash the game. For example, I replaced the male squire job with the custom male warrior w/ the spiked hair as a test. It all worked well until I got to the 2nd battle of the game at Garliand (the battle right after orbonne monastary). When I killed the special squire (the one with the special portrait) I left him there to crystalize and when it came to be his turn (the crystalization turn if that's even a word xD) the game would just freeze and shut off my psp. Any help out there that can let me know wuts going wrong?

Secondly, I'd really like to learn how to get custom sprites on the formation screen for PSP but Lyndn's tutorial on the website is confusing.. I opened shishi and couldnt find the pallete option. :( can anyone show me?

Finally... (sorry for such a long post D:) is there any way to edit in game storyline text? I tried using the hacktext program but that only edits menu and UI words.

I'm getting the same sort of crash midway into battle, but I haven't applied any sprite modifications in my patch (just some modifications with FFTPatcher). My first suspicions were that the patch was applied onto the PSP version of the game, which is rendered and may be hardcoded differently than its preceding PSX version, but I've heard accounts from other people that their patches work fine and they can grind endlessly without any crashes.

Also, to edit in-game storyline text, you would need to fiddle with the Event Compiler/Decompiler. I believe you can download that program on the home page of FFHacktics.
